Applications Across Industries
E6010 welding rods are widely used in various sectors
1. Construction In the construction industry, E6010 rods are frequently used for welding structural steel, reinforcing bars, and other components. Their strong penetration makes them ideal for heavy-duty constructions.
2. Shipbuilding The maritime industry relies heavily on the durability and reliability of welds for shipbuilding. E6010 rods are often used in the construction and repair of ships due to their excellent performance in challenging environments.
3. Automotive Repair Mechanics utilize E6010 rods to repair vehicle frames and other metal components, where a strong and clean weld is necessary to ensure vehicle safety.
4. Pipe Welding E6010 rods are considered an industry standard for pipe welding, especially in situations where a deep penetration weld is required to withstand high pressure.
